The Rise of Amsterdam’s Greenhouse Gastronomy: Farm-to-Table Innovation
This farm-to-table approach results in dishes where the flavors are intense and the provenance is undeniable, often presented with stories about the specific plants growing outside the kitchen window. Chefs work closely with the on-site gardeners to plan harvests, ensuring that herbs, vegetables, and microgreens are picked at peak ripeness.
